YouTuber accused of evading tax on $400K Ferrari that he filmed being destroyed in fire
Arts And Entertainment,YouTube,Social Media,Taxes,Criminal Justice
A wildly popular YouTube star has been arrested for allegedly evading taxes while buying a $400,000 Ferrari that he then filmed being destroyed in a raging fire.
Cody Detwiler, 27, who has more than 10 million subscribers to his “WhistlinDiesel” channel, faces two felony counts of tax evasion related to sales tax on a 2020 Ferrari F8 Tributo, purchased in January 2023, TMZ reported, citing law enforcement sources.
It matches the Ferrari F8 that the influencer filmed being destroyed in a field fire in an August 2023 video titled, “The fastest way to lose half a million Dollars. My Ferrari is gone.”...
